TucsonClip wrote:I think we need Randolph in order to hit our peak expectations next season. Problem is, im hesitant to believe Randolph can rein in his game and buy into the role to become the player we need.
This is 100% where I'm at, except I think we could peak without Randolph. His ability to make his game fit his role is the biggest question with him.

I think people look at his percentages and miss how much his shot selection changed them. When you take 11.6 shots, 2 crappy, contested shots means the difference between 38% and 45%. I felt he was reliably good for at least two bad, unforced, low percentage shots a game. If he stops doing that, that alone would skyrocket his efficiency.

Randolph could have a plenty big role shooting off screens and spacing the floor as a catch-and-shoot threat... if he was an actual shooting threat. I projected a lot of growth out of him for 2018-19 and I was wildly wrong. Getting tired of expecting too much out of any of these guys.

We will have a need for three point shooting - no one on the team is a proven threat. Nico I believe in. Armstrong is probably respectable at the next level but who knows. Green doesn't shoot from outside consistently.

Need floor spacers... if Randolph dials that in, even just that niche role, he'd get a ton of minutes. If it's DD or Smith even who does it instead, fine by me.
